Gustavus launches new trip planning Web site
GUSTAVUS - The Gustavus Visitor's Association announces the launch of www.gustavusak.com. People considering a trip to Glacier Bay National Park can now plan their trip using on-line planning tools, maps, and business directories.
"Gustavus is not only the gateway to Glacier Bay National Park," said Rachel Parks, President of the Gustavus Visitor's Association. "It also is a truly unique Southeast Alaskan community. We have miles of sandy beaches, a range of accommodations including world-class inns, bed and breakfasts, vacation homes and budget cabins; and many great things to do and see like whale watching, flightseeing, charter fishing, art galleries, kayaking tours, and dog mushing. The list really is endless."
From its early homesteading history to today, Gustavus businesses have extended true Alaskan hospitality. Gustavus is located only 20 minutes west of Juneau via air and there is summer ferry service from Juneau to Gustavus beginning today. The community welcomes independent travelers to Glacier Bay National Park.
